THE FACTS
When is Montpellier vs Leinster taking place? Saturday 12th December, 2020 – 17:30 (UK)
Where is Montpellier vs Leinster taking place? GGL Stadium, Montpellier
Where can I get tickets for Montpellier vs Leinster? Visit official club websites for ticket information
What television channel is Montpellier vs Leinster on? This match will be televised live on BT Sport
Where can I stream Montpellier vs Leinster? BT Sport subscribers can stream the match live via the BT Sport website & app

THE PREDICTION
The only thing that can stop high-flying Leinster at the moment in the Pro14 is postponements and they lost the lead in the table to Ulster last weekend, though with a game in-hand. They will be eager to stretch their wings in this prestigious tournament but may not have it all their own way against Montpellier, who stopped Clermont Auvergne last time out in the Top 14. The hosts have so many games in hand that they could well be a phantom top three side in the French league and the long trip for Leinster will benefit the hosts. However, Leinster have simply been too good so far this season to warrant going against them here. They have a massive +204 points difference in the Pro14 after just seven games and their staggeringly solid defence should help them to cover -8 on the road in what could be a tight one.
